• dot1p -Sets the dynamic classification to trust dot1p. • fallback-(Optional) Honor trusting 802.1p (dot1p) only if other match criteria in this policy-map fails to qualify for a packet. Honor 802.1p priorities on ingress traffic OS10(config)# policy-map policy-trust OS10(conf-pmap-qos)# class class-trust OS10(conf-pmap-c-qos)# trust dot1p View policy-map OS10(conf-pmap-c-qos)# do show policy-map Service-policy(qos) input: policy-trust Class-map (qos): class-trust trust dot1p Queue selection OS10 does not honor DSCP values on ingress traffic by default. Honoring DSCP means assigning a traffic-class ID implicitly based on the incoming packets. You can use the trust command under the reserved class-map name class-trust to enable honoring DSCP. The following limitations apply to S5148F-ON: • Global clearing of queue statistics are applied to 576 UC , 576 MC and 12CPU Queues. Dell EMC recommends to use type specific clear statistics. • Bandwidth weight is equally applied to UC and MC. • The mapping of traffic class to queue must be applied on egress port. Table 3. Default DSCP to Queue Mapping DSCP/CP hex range (XXX)xxx DSCP definition / traditional IP precedence 111XXX 110XXX 101XXX 100XXX 011XXX 010XXX 001XXX 000XXX -/ network control -/internetwork control EF, expedited forwarding / CRITIC/ECP AF4, assured forwarding / flash override AF3 / flash AF2 / immediate AF1 / priority BE, best effort / best effort Internal queue ID / DSCP/CP decimal - 8-queue 7 / 56-63 6 / 48-55 5 / 40-47 4 / 32-39 3 / 24-31 2 / 16-23 1 / 8-15 0 / 0-7 1 Create a policy-map, and configure a name for the policy-map in CONFIGURATION mode. policy-map [type qos] policy-map-name 2 Associate the class-trust class-map with the policy-map in POLICY-MAP-CLASS-MAP mode. class-map class-trust 3 Honor incoming IP packets to classify this packet to a traffic-class ID in POLICY-MAP mode. trust {diffserv} [fallback] • diffserv -Sets the dynamic traffic-class to trust DSCP. If a policy-map has trust (dot1p or diffserv) enabled and has ACLbased classification, only trust-based classification is used. • fallback-(Optional) Honor trusting DSCP only if other match criteria in this policy-map does not apply to a packet. If a policymap has trust (dot1p or fallback) enabled and has ACL-based classification, the packet is assigned a priority using trust-based classification -trust is the fallback mechanism for ACL classification conflicts.
